Welcome to Denison, Texas—a charming city that beautifully blends small-town warmth with modern conveniences. Nestled in Grayson County, just a stone's throw from the stunning shores of Lake Texoma, Denison boasts a rich history, vibrant community spirit, and a plethora of outdoor activities that make it a perfect place to call home.

Denison is renowned for its picturesque landscapes and friendly neighborhoods, making it an ideal setting for families, retirees, and anyone seeking a close-knit community. The city is steeped in history, featuring beautifully preserved buildings and a thriving downtown area filled with unique shops, delightful eateries, and local art galleries. With a strong emphasis on community events, residents enjoy a calendar packed with festivals, farmer's markets, and outdoor concerts that bring everyone together.

One of the standout features of Denison's real estate market is the availability of homes with native plant lots. These properties not only enhance the natural beauty of the area but also promote biodiversity and sustainability. Imagine stepping into your backyard, where native flora flourishes, providing a habitat for local wildlife and a serene escape for you and your family. Homes with native plant lots are designed to blend harmoniously with the environment, offering low-maintenance landscaping that thrives in the Texas climate.
